After cooking the steak I remove it to rest and add a nob of butter on low heat. Scrape up any brown bits from the pan.
Add a splash of cream. Add some steak seasoning,salt and pepper and /or a splash of port and pour over meat.
Not sure cream equals low calorie but it's yummy.

I make a gravy/ sauce with a mushroom base. It freezes well

Sauté mushrooms and onions if desired. Throw in a blender. Add beef or broth of choice, garlic, Sage, oregano, salt and pepper to taste. Blend. add more broth to desired consistency. Great as a thanksgiving turkey gravy!!!

For gammon or fish - loads of chopped parsley warm some creme fraiche add parsley and season, also good is ream cheese warmed and add cooked leeks or cooked mushrooms

I love flavoured butters for steaks, fish and chicken and you can keep them in the freezer and just slice a bit off and place it on top of whatever your having melts slowly and gives a lovely flavour. Your imagination is your only limit with butters use herbs, lemon, chilli, spices, anything you can add

I also like creme fraiche with cheese as a cheese sauce for cauliflower, leeks broccoli or anything you like. I don't use cream much as I'm not keen prefer the acidity of creme fraiche

Instant cheese sauce; warm some double cream, crumble in some cheese, warm gently until cheese melts into the cream. Job done.
